Looking for a driver for asus motherboard

I have vista x64 installed, and I got 2 question marks.unknown device
hardware id profiles are

ACPI\PNPB02F
*PNPB02F
&
ACPI\PNPB006
*PNPB006
cant find drivers for them

I have (P5ND2-SLI Deluxe) motherboard and the Chipset are:

1-Nvidia nForce 4 SLI - Intel Edition

2-Nvidia MCP-04

Re: Looking for a driver for asus motherboard

Rick:
Those two unknown devices are the MIDI Port and the Joystick Gameport.
Microsoft dropped support of them as of Windows XP x64.
We are all out of luck in this case and there is no hope in finding any
drivers.
Old Gameport Joysticks will have to be replaced (i.e.: buy a new one) by USB
Joysticks.
